The leaves are falling, the air is crisp, pumpkin spice everything is back. Needless to say, fall is here, which means our seasonal itch for a fall refresh is in full swing.

Fortunately, you don’t need to tear down that divider wall in the dining room, DIY a bookshelf or buy a new bedroom set to change things up and get into the fall spirit. Small and inexpensive changes can cozy up your home within minutes ― like adding a scented candle to the kitchen, hanging a sign wood-framed sign in the entryway, or tossing a few faux-fur pillows onto the couch for an added level of coziness.

Here are 10 ways (all under $70!) to make your home feel extra cozy, just in time for fall:
